Serieshd
Movie
TV
Watchlist
API
Bella Lo
17 Aug, 1987 in Macao (now Macao SAR, China)
Also Known As:
Bella Law Chi-Kiu
Annabella Lo
Movie
Tv Series
Sifu vs. Vampire
54%
(2014)
Comedy
,
Fantasy
,
Action
,
Horror
Flirting in the Air
60%
(2014)
Comedy
From Vegas to Macau II
51%
(2015)
Comedy
Wild City
57%
(2015)
Thriller
,
Action
,
Crime